Shade Choice Tips
Choosing the ideal color for a match is vital, as it can considerably affect your general appearance and the impact you leave on others. When choosing a match shade, take into consideration the celebration and the message you wish to share. For official events, timeless colors such as navy, charcoal grey, and black are ideal, as they show professionalism and trust and class.
On the other hand, for less formal setups, such as page casual fridays or social gatherings, lighter tones like off-white, light grey, or pastel colors can include a refreshing touch while still preserving a sleek look. It's also crucial to think about your complexion; warmer skin tones generally enhance earth tones and warmer shades, while cooler complexion tend to integrate with blues and jewel tones.
Furthermore, take into consideration the period when selecting fit colors. Darker shades are commonly chosen in autumn and winter months, while lighter tones are extra appropriate for spring and summertime. Fit and Tailoring Basics
Achieving the best fit is paramount to showcasing a fit's elegance and boosting the wearer's self-confidence. A well-fitted fit must contour the body without constricting motion, striking the equilibrium in between convenience and style. To guarantee an optimum fit, interest has to be paid to numerous crucial locations: shoulders, upper body, midsection, and sleeves.
The shoulders must align completely with the user's natural shoulder line, avoiding any type of sagging or tightness. The upper body needs to permit a minor gap when buttoned, ensuring comfort while preserving a customized look. The waist of the jacket need to taper slightly to produce a flattering shape, while the trousers need to fit pleasantly around the waist without the demand for a belt to hold them up.
Sleeve length is also essential; ideally, the coat sleeves must finish read review just over the wrist, permitting a glimpse of the tee shirt cuff. The trouser length should strike the right balance-- either relaxing carefully on the footwear for a clean appearance or breaking a little for a more loosened up style.
